At the heart of Libra Meme Coin’s narrative lies a blend of community-driven momentum and viral appeal. Unlike conventional cryptocurrencies backed by fundamentals or technological innovation, meme coins thrive on cultural resonance, social media engagement, and collective belief. For Libra Meme Coin, this translates into a bot-driven growth model: accelerated token distribution via airdrops, algorithmic trading bots amplifying visibility, and memes cascading across platforms like Twitter, Reddit, and TikTok.
“It’s not just about the coin—” says veteran crypto analyst Elena Torres—“it’s about the ecosystem. When enough people rally around a meme identity, scarcity reaches new psychological thresholds.” This community amplification creates a self-reinforcing loop where rising prices attract more investors, who in turn drive momentum, distorting price mechanics beyond rational valuation.
Price prediction models forecasting a Libra Meme Coin "moon" hinge on several measurable yet volatile factors. Technical indicators such as on-chain activity, network participation, and token velocity offer clues.
For instance, a steep increase in transaction volume or rising address activity suggests stronger adoption, which aligns with bullish narratives. Leveraged by algorithms that detect sorting-up patterns, these signals fuel investor confidence. But technical momentum alone rarely sustains explosive gains—market psychology plays an equally decisive role.
Social sentiment, quantified through tools tracking mentions and meme virality, often predicts short-term breakouts.
Key drivers underpinning the price projection include:
- Viral Catalysts: Memes featuring central figures (symbolic or absurd) trend quickly, triggering surges in visibility. For example, a single viral TikTok video featuring the coin’s logo with a catchy slogan can spike attention within hours.
- Decentralized Distribution: Libra Meme Coin’s airdrop strategy—releasing large token pools to eager communities—creates immediate liquidity and feeds scarcity post-launch, a psychological trigger long exploited in crypto cycles.
- Speculative Momentum: Weekly trading volume spikes often exceed monthly averages by orders of magnitude, indicating outsized participation from retail traders chasing rapid movements.
- Influencer Endorsement: Collaborations with micro-influencers and animation creators generate endless meme content, normalizing the coin in everyday digital culture.
Yet, the path to a true moon—defined as a sustained price jump to $1+ per token with institutional or real-world adoption—remains uncertain. Historical data from similar meme coins shows that while many surge 10x or more in months, long-term sustainability hinges on utility beyond hype.
“Many meme tokens struggle,” notes Torres. “The community keeps it alive, but actual use cases and real transaction volume are the true litmus test.” Predictive models projecting 9–12× returns often ignore this critical threshold: viral peaks fade without enduring demand.

Market Users and Investors Should:
- Scrutinize technical charts for breakouts but expect volatility; price spikes may outpace logic.
- Research token distribution and airdrop mechanics—excessive institutional flipping risks early sell-offs.
- Track organic engagement metrics such as meme volume, social reach, and decentralized exchange activity for early indicators.
- Avoid equating fan-driven hype with long-term value; utility and adoption sustain genuine growth.
